Missing Sender information from SMTP Magento 2

Published: 9/3/2018

This is a frustrating Magento 2 issue whereby the "Sender" information in an email is actually removed/stripped from the email that the customer receives.


This is bad as most email clients such as GMail will simply reject this email, meaning your customer will never get notified of their order!

The reason for this is that Magento 2.2.5 (and possible 2.2.4) comes pre-packaged with a few 3rd-party modules which interfere with your SMTP extension.

In order to rectify this and get your email header back to normal you should disable these 3rd-party modules.

php bin/magento module:disable Klarna_Core Amazon_Core Amazon_Login Amazon_Payment Klarna_Ordermanagement Klarna_Kp Vertex_Tax

Of course, if you're using some of these then you'll have to pick and choose which ones to remove. I'm not 100% sure but I think the culprit is the Amazon_Core extension, so if you're using Amazon Pay you'll probably have to implement a different fix.